Answer:
Three equivalents ratios for 6/9 could be 2/3, 12/18 and 18/27
Step-by-step explanation:
An equivalent ratio refers to the same number but written differently. For example, for the ratio 6/9, we could obtain the following equivalent ratios.
First equivalent ratio
You can divide the numerator and denominator by 3. You get 2/3

Second equivalent ratio
You can multiply the numerator and denominator by 2. You get 12/18

Third equivalent ratio
You can multiply the numerator and denominator by 3. You get 18/27

Thus, three equivalents ratios for 6/9 could be 2/3, 12/18 and 18/27
